What does the word "Cornerback" mean?

The term "cornerback" refers to a key position in American football, primarily responsible for covering receivers and defending against pass plays. In the fast-paced and strategic world of football, the role of a cornerback is crucial in determining the success of a team's defensive strategies. This article will delve into the meaning, responsibilities, and skills associated with this vital position.

Cornerbacks are typically positioned on the outer edges of the defense, aligning with the opposing team's wide receivers. Their main goal is to prevent the receiver from catching the ball, while also being prepared to defend against runs or play actions.
